Fun-filled parody of the original

A bizarre, unconventional, almost anachronistic parody of the original 36th Chamber, Return to the 36th Chamber is just as much fun as its predecessor albeit for very different reasons. Equal parts spoof and as it is a straightforward martial arts actioner, the film recasts Gordon Liu as a down-on-his-luck con artist learning the ropes from the very character he played in the original, one that pushes Liu's comedic chops to the forefront and one he pulls off exceptionally well. The lighter tone and bigger focus on comedy oddly work in the film's favour, it's a welcome change of pace in direct contrast to the original, one that I found myself laughing at consistently. Lau Kar-leung maintains his stunning direction with just as much emphasis here on training sequences versus actual fighting which are once again a fantastic sight to behold. Admittedly, some aspects of the plot don't hold up to intensive scrutiny, but for what it is, Return to the 36th Chamber works. A fun-filled, highly engaging piece with a heightened sense of reality that will please fans and newcomers alike.

where the story and inner voice of the characters are more important than genre stereotypes.

Stereotypes of films like “The Count of Monte Cristo” have accustomed us to the standard plot lines of such stories: a strong hero/heroine, betrayal, years in prison that transform and temper their character, liberation, a plan for revenge, a cunning opponent whom the hero/heroine defeats due to their extreme coolness. In the South Korean “Revolver”, everything will be different: depending on your expectations, this will be either a cool feature or an annoying misunderstanding. The woman did not become stronger in prison - she is broken both morally and physically: as a former police officer, she was constantly beaten. The scene of liberation paints an accurate portrait of her: no family, no friends, no place to live, only scars on her body. She challenges the powerful villains who deceived the police, she decides to do so for a purely pragmatic reason - she has nothing to live on. The villains turn out to be not so influential and these are only bureaucrats whose “right hand does not know what the left hand is doing.” Moreover, they did not seem to be planning to deceive her - just, as happens in life, something went wrong. For almost two hours you will have to follow the chaotic actions of the heroine and her either friends or enemies. The outcome of such a story is unpredictable - having broken the initial axioms, we can end up anywhere in the finale. For some reason, this approach reminded me of Hayao Miyazaki’s stories, where powerful villains often turn out to be weak and worthy of sympathy. The film also has a detective component. This authorial and plot confusion seemed original and exciting. So I would definitely recommend “Revolver” to fans of non-standard action films, where the story and inner voice of the characters are more important than genre stereotypes.

A World of Deviant, Horrible People!

The film strives to be inspirational and sentimental, but it comes up short on both. In the beginning, we find ourselves cheering and rooting for Loh Kiwan, hoping that he can find a better life than the one he’s been living in North Korea and China.

Loh Kiwan emigrates to Belgium with the hope of starting a new life. He has only the money his mother left him as well as whatever money were obtained by selling her corpse. In Belgium, we find that Kiwan has traded one bad situation for another. He has to wait several months before he can apply for asylum. He’s beaten up by thugs, and he has his wallet stolen by Marie, another North Korean defector who has been living in Belgium with her father. Marie is a rather disgusting woman who smokes, does drugs, and finds herself in the clutches of a ruthless underworld Belgian gang. Of course, it’s hard to sympathize with a woman as immature and cowardly as Marie is. After all, she made her world what it is, while Kiwan is trying to change his.

Kiwan finds himself sleeping in public bathrooms or anywhere he can find shelter against the bitter winter cold. After a time, he finally finds himself a job in a slaughterhouse. Once again, a former North Korean defector vows to help him, only to betray him when he needs her help the most. It seems that Kiwan can’t seem to catch a break anywhere. The Belgian government requires proof that he’s a North Korean defector since many Chinese have used that in order to gain residence in the country.

Meanwhile, Marie is an expert marksman with guns, and she’s used by the Belgian gang boss to earn money and help him pay off his debt. Caught up in the world of drugs and violence, Marie doesn’t see anything changing. A typical rebellious daughter, who doesn’t know the truth about her own mother’s death, uses it as an excuse for her pathetic life.

In the end, we wonder just who is saving whom. We initially believe that Marie will help Kiwan, but in the end, it’s pretty much the reverse as Kiwan finally helps Marie escape the horrible underworld, but at the price of leaving the country.

The story is based upon a book written by Marie about Loh Kiwan. I’d be interested in finding out how much of this film is fact or dramatized. The film could have been so much better. While it’s brutal in its honesty, its attempt to be romantic and sentimental fail. Marie is hardly appealing in any way, shape, or form, and the ultimate hero of the story is Kiwan for finding some way to keep on going, even after the beatings, the betrayals, and being in a country where very little ever goes right for him. Kiwan is clearly made of sterner stuff, and he’s a far stronger person than Marie could ever hope to be. Marie is simply petulant and cowardly.

Peformances were very good in this film. It’s just too bad that it wasn’t nearly as inspirational as it could have been. It certainly doesn’t paint a very good picture of Belgium as a country either. Given his limited funds, Kiwan isn’t able to simply leave and go somewhere else until the end when he finally meets Marie in Madagascar, which is where the film ends. Ironically, it’s also the only scene in the film where there is actual sunlight. It’s almost as if the rest of the world is dark, gray, and bleak. Unfortunately, most of this film is that way too. Overall, the film was a disappointment, which is a shame given the story and performances.

A Surprising Gem that Redefines Expectations

When I heard the movie is available on Netflix, I decided to watch it with no expectations — after all, it’s a GMMTV production, just another Thai idol movie full of pretty faces.

But I found myself wrong!! I completely captivated by the movie!!

Despite being the third remake after the original version, the story unfolds with a sense of raw authenticity that immediately draws you in, and this is largely thanks to the compelling performances by Yaya and Bright. Both actors bring a natural, unpolished quality to their roles, which feels refreshing and genuine. Yaya, in particular, does an outstanding job of building a dynamic connection with Bright on screen, creating a unique chemistry that, while awkward at moments, adds depth to the narrative. It’s evident that Yaya manages to pull Bright out of his comfort zone, encouraging him to explore a broader emotional range and add more nuance to his performance.

What truly stands out in "Love You To Debt" is the surprising balance between lighthearted moments and deeper, more meaningful themes. The film explores the complexities of relationships and personal growth, and the chemistry between the two leads feels both sincere and relatable. There’s a certain charm in how their characters interact, highlighting the awkwardness and unpredictability of real-life connections. Even though it is the third remake, the film brings a fresh perspective and a new energy that makes it feel just as original and engaging as the first. It’s a testament to the director’s vision and the actors' talent that this version stands out on its own.

For Bright, this film could serve as a critical portfolio piece that helps him break away from his well-known persona as a BL (Boys' Love) actor and his idol image from "F4 Thailand." His performance in this role demonstrates his versatility and range, showing that he is capable of much more than the types of roles he has previously been associated with. This could be a significant step in expanding his horizons and paving the way for more diverse and challenging roles in the future, which would be highly beneficial for his acting career - if he wants to.

The film would likely have been even more successful had it been released before "Lahn Mah" and prior to any controversy surrounding the lead actor’s (Bright) personal life. It's unfortunate that such a trivial matter — his dating life — overshadowed his talent on screen. If not for the social media drama, this movie had all the ingredients to become a potential blockbuster.

The film is further elevated by its strong technical elements. The editing is sharp, ensuring a smooth narrative flow that keeps viewers engaged from start to finish. Additionally, the soundtrack plays a significant role in enhancing the emotional undertone of the story. In particular, the song "นะหน้าทอง" by โจอี้ ภูวศิษฐ์ (JOEY PHUWASIT) resonates beautifully with the film's themes and adds another layer of depth to the viewing experience.

Overall, "Love You To Debt" is a surprisingly heartfelt and engaging film that blends good acting, genuine chemistry, and solid production values. It's a delightful watch that leaves a lasting impression, proving that sometimes the best discoveries are the ones you least expect — even if they come as the third version of a familiar story.
